Clamping hoop and waterborne photovoltaic platform fixed thereby
A clamp and platform technology, applied in the field of photovoltaic products, can solve the problems of large water surface area, insufficient rigidity, and large environmental impact, and achieve the effects of small environmental impact, long maintenance period, and strong corrosion resistance.
